Panama Rocks is set to come alive with the sounds of nature, the sights of vibrant art, and the aromas of delicious food as the Wild America Nature Festival returns on July 18 & 19, 2026 from 10:00 AM to 5:00 PM each day, promising a weekend full of fun and excitement for all ages.

With over 40 art, craft and food vendors, the Wild America Nature Festival brings in world class painters, jewelers, woodworkers, ceramic artists, fabrics, blacksmithing, and more! The festival is known for the quality and diversity of its art and craft show. The art and craft vendors sell items that they have personally created. Each vendor either specializes in art related to nature, such as painting and photography, or uses natural, organic materials in their work.

FOOD VENDORS include: Labyrinth Press Co., Another Guy’s Fries, Best of Buffalo by Byron, Ramsey Concessions, Ace Kettle Corn, Everyday's a SUNDAE, and Hope’s Smoothies. There are food options for everyone including vegetarian, gluten-free, and allergy-friendly food!

WILD ENTERTAINMENT! One of the most thrilling and educational experiences at the Wild America Nature Festival is the captivating animal presentations by Jungle Terry, Hawk Creek, and WILD Creatures. Featuring a diverse array of animals, from slithering snakes and lively lizards to exotic birds and cuddly mammals. Children and adults alike are mesmerized as you learn fascinating facts and stories about each animal, highlighting their unique characteristics and behaviors.

The Sun Dance Kids PETTING ZOO is a delightful attraction at the Wild America Nature Festival, offering a hands-on experience with a variety of friendly farm animals. Children and adults alike can interact with goats, sheep, rabbits, and other gentle creatures in a safe and engaging environment.

The festival also features FOLK MUSIC by Davis and Eng and nature walks and talks on topics such as our native ecosystem, wild edible foraging, wildlife rehabilitation, and more!
